站在2026年的技术前沿回望,鸿蒙系统(HarmonyOS)的开发基础已从早期的AOSP(Android Open Source Project)依赖,彻底转向了以OpenHarmony为核心的全栈自研架构。这一演进路径清晰地划分为三个阶段,为行业提供了从“兼容”到“原生”的典型范式。
第一阶段是2019年至2022年的“兼容期”。鸿蒙1.0和2.0版本基于AOSP内核进行开发,通过分布式软总线技术实现多设备互联。这一阶段的战略价值在于快速构建生态,但底层仍依赖Linux内核与安卓框架,存在性能瓶颈与安全问题。第二阶段是2023年至2025年的“换核期”。随着OpenHarmony 3.0以上版本的成熟,华为逐步将智能终端、穿戴设备迁移至自研的微内核架构。微内核仅保留进程调度、IPC通信等最小核心功能,而将文件系统、网络协议栈等以用户态服务运行。这种设计将系统性能提升了30%以上,同时通过形式化验证技术将安全漏洞减少90%。第三阶段是2026年及以后的“全场景原生期”。最新发布的HarmonyOS NEXT已完全移除AOSP代码,所有应用必须基于ArkTS语言和ArkUI框架开发。
从技术架构看,鸿蒙系统的演进本质是从“宏内核向微内核”的迁移。与之对比,安卓系统仍基于Linux宏内核,在资源受限的IoT设备上存在冗余问题。而鸿蒙的微内核架构天然支持确定性时延,可满足工业控制、智能汽车等场景的实时性要求。据行业预测,到2027年,全球将有超过50%的智能设备采用微内核或混合内核架构,鸿蒙已占据先发优势。
对于开发者,理解这一演进路径至关重要。若您正在规划基于鸿蒙的软件定制项目,建议优先采用ArkTS语言进行原生开发。对于遗留安卓应用,可通过鸿蒙的“兼容转换工具”进行自动化迁移,但需注意,部分依赖Google服务的功能必须重构。未来五年,鸿蒙将形成“手机+车机+PC+IoT”的超级终端矩阵,其开发基础已不再是“基于什么系统”,而是“如何构建全场景原生应用”。这正是鸿蒙从技术跟随者转变为规则制定者的核心标志。